Core i7-11700F vs Ryzen 5 8600G specs and performance
According to the hardwareDB Benchmark tool, the Core i7-11700F is faster than the Ryzen 5 8600G. Despite this, the Ryzen 5 8600G has the advantage in our gaming benchmark.
With info from our database, we find that the Core i7-11700F has slightly more cores with 8 cores whereas the Ryzen 5 8600G has 6 cores. It also has more threads than the Ryzen 5 8600G. These CPUs have different clock speeds. Indeed, the Ryzen 5 8600G has a significantly higher clock speed compared to the Core i7-11700F. Also, the Ryzen 5 8600G has a slightly higher turbo speed. Both these chips have an identical TDP (Thermal Design Power). This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ption. The info from our database shows that the Ryzen 5 8600G has more L2 cache than the Core i7-11700F. However, both these chips have the same amount of L3 cache.
Most CPUs have more threads than cores. This technology, colloquially called hyperthreading, improves performance by splitting a core into multiple virtual ones. This provides more efficient utilisation of a core. Indeed, the Core i7-11700F has more threads than cores. Each physical core is split into multiple threads.
